From c719f4bd11916ee2075e17ebc3568b37c90c3621 Mon Sep 17 00:00:00 2001 From: Leandro Nunes dos Santos Date: Tue, 7 Jan 2014 19:04:27 -0300 Subject: [PATCH] UserTest: avatar information could come in different url positions --- test/unit/user_test.rb | 14 +++++++++----- 1 file changed, 9 insertions(+), 5 deletions(-) diff --git a/test/unit/user_test.rb b/test/unit/user_test.rb index a5da4c4..ca1468c 100644 --- a/test/unit/user_test.rb +++ b/test/unit/user_test.rb @@ -337,10 +337,8 @@ class UserTest < ActiveSupport::TestCase Person.any_instance.stubs(:created_at).returns(DateTime.parse('16-08-2010')) expected_hash = { 'login' => 'x_and_y', 'is_admin' => true, 'since_month' => 8, - 'chat_enabled' => false, 'since_year' => 2010, 'avatar' => - 'http://www.gravatar.com/avatar/a0517761d5125820c28d87860bc7c02e?only_path=false&d=&size=20', - 'email_domain' => nil, 'amount_of_friends' => 0, - 'friends_list' => {}, 'enterprises' => [], + 'chat_enabled' => false, 'since_year' => 2010, 'email_domain' => nil, + 'amount_of_friends' => 0, 'friends_list' => {}, 'enterprises' => [], } assert_equal expected_hash['login'], person.user.data_hash['login'] @@ -348,7 +346,13 @@ class UserTest < ActiveSupport::TestCase assert_equal expected_hash['since_month'], person.user.data_hash['since_month'] assert_equal expected_hash['chat_enabled'], person.user.data_hash['chat_enabled'] assert_equal expected_hash['since_year'], person.user.data_hash['since_year'] - assert_equal expected_hash['avatar'], person.user.data_hash['avatar'] + + # Avatar stuff + assert_match 'http://www.gravatar.com/avatar/a0517761d5125820c28d87860bc7c02e', person.user.data_hash['avatar'] + assert_match 'only_path=false', person.user.data_hash['avatar'] + assert_match 'd=', person.user.data_hash['avatar'] + assert_match 'size=20', person.user.data_hash['avatar'] + assert_equal expected_hash['email_domain'], person.user.data_hash['email_domain'] assert_equal expected_hash['amount_of_friends'], person.user.data_hash['amount_of_friends'] assert_equal expected_hash['friends_list'], person.user.data_hash['friends_list'] -- libgit2 0.21.2